    KROHNE is a global manufacturer and provider of instrumentation, measurement solutions and services. Founded in 1921 and headquartered in Duisburg, Germany, we offer extensive application knowledge and local contacts for instrumentation projects in over 100 countries. KROHNE stands for innovation and high quality products as one of the market leaders in the process industry. KROHNE specializes in process measurement – from field instrumentation to system solutions – and is a full-service provider for flow, level, pressure, temperature and process analytics products, accompanied by a broad range of services. We have proven experience working with many customers across most industries, including but not limited to chemical, oil & gas, food & beverage, water & wastewater, power generation and distribution, marine, as well as mechanical and plant engineering. Today, KROHNE employs more than 4, 000 people, operates 15 production facilities and owns 44 companies worldwide while remaining an independent, family-owned company.     ESTABLISHED: In 2009, GREISINGER electronic, Honsberg Instruments and Martens Elektronik merged to create GHM Messtechnik – a complete provider for measuring technology and industrial electronics. RESOURCES With around 300 employees and over 35 developers at a total of seven sites – in Erolzheim, Regenstauf, Remscheid, Barsbüttel, Owingen, Kassel and Padua/Italy – GHM Messtechnik is able to offer a complete range of products for the wide variety of requirements relating to measuring technology.     BERNSTEIN AG, headquartered in Porta Westfalica, looks back on an eventful past that is linked directly to Germany’s most recent history. In 1947 Hans Bernstein founded the company “Hans Bernstein Spezialfabrik für Schaltkontakte”, from which BERNSTEIN AG – today operates internationally – emerged. The family owned company is now in it’s third generation and today employs more than 500 people in 10 countries. In-depth market knowledge, the close proximity to end users, as well as years of experience in mechanical engineering and electronics, are reflected down to the last detail in our products. Against this backdrop, BERNSTEIN ranks among the world’s leading providers of industrial safety and enclosure technology. With our comprehensive range of switches, sensors, enclosures and operator terminals and suspension systems, we offer our customers effective and versatile solutions.
